Add-PublicFolderAdministrativePermission (RTM)
Aplica-se a: Exchange Server 2007
Tópico modificado em: 2007-06-17
Use o cmdlet Add-PublicFolderAdministrativePermission para adicionar permissões administrativas a uma pasta pública ou uma hierarquia de pasta pública.
Sintaxe
Add-PublicFolderAdministrativePermission -Identity <PublicFolderIdParameter> -AccessRights <Collection> -User <SecurityPrincipalIdParameter> [-Deny <SwitchParameter>] [-DomainController <Fqdn>] [-InheritanceType <None | All | Descendents | SelfAndChildren | Children>] [-Server <ServerIdParameter>]
Add-PublicFolderAdministrativePermission -Identity <PublicFolderIdParameter> -Owner <SecurityPrincipalIdParameter> [-DomainController <Fqdn>] [-Server <ServerIdParameter>]
Add-PublicFolderAdministrativePermission [-Identity <PublicFolderIdParameter>] -Instance <PublicFolderAdministrativeAceObject> [-AccessRights <Collection>] [-Deny <SwitchParameter>] [-DomainController <Fqdn>] [-InheritanceType <None | All | Descendents | SelfAndChildren | Children>] [-Server <ServerIdParameter>] [-User <SecurityPrincipalIdParameter>]
Descrição detalhada
Para executar o cmdlet Add-PublicFolderAdministrativePermission, você deve usar a conta à qual esteja delegada a seguinte função:
- Função Administrador da Organização do Exchange
Para obter mais informações sobre permissões, delegação de funções e os direitos necessários para administrar o Exchange Server 2007, consulte Considerações sobre permissão.
Parâmetros
Parâmetro | Necessário | Tipo | Descrição |
---|---|---|---|
AccessRights |
Necessário |
System.Collections.ObjectModel.Collection |
O parâmetro AccessRights especifica os direitos que estão sendo adicionados. Os valores válidos incluem:
|
DomainController |
Opcional |
Microsoft.Exchange.Data.Fqdn |
O parâmetro DomainController especifica o controlador de domínio a ser usado para gravar essa alteração de configuração no Active Directory. Use o nome de domínio totalmente qualificado (FQDN) do controlador de domínio a ser usado. |
Identity |
Necessário |
Microsoft.Exchange.Configuration.Tasks.PublicFolderIdParameter |
Utilize o parâmetro Identity para especificar a GUID ou o nome da pasta pública que representa uma pasta pública específica. Você pode também incluir o caminho utilizando o formato TopLevelPublicFolder\PublicFolder. Você pode omitir o rótulo do parâmetro Identity para que somente o nome da pasta pública ou a GUID seja fornecido. |
Instance |
Necessário |
Microsoft.Exchange.Management.MapiTasks.PublicFolderAdministrativeAceObject |
O parâmetro Instance permite que você passe um objeto inteiro para o comando a ser processado. Ele é usado principalmente quando um objeto inteiro deve ser passado para o comando. |
Owner |
Necessário |
Microsoft.Exchange.Configuration.Tasks.SecurityPrincipalIdParameter |
O parâmetro Owner especifica a ACL (lista de controle de acesso) do Proprietário NT no objeto. Os valores válidos são o nome UPN, o domínio\usuário ou o alias. |
User |
Necessário |
Microsoft.Exchange.Configuration.Tasks.SecurityPrincipalIdParameter |
O parâmetro User especifica o nome UPN, domínio\usuário ou alias do usuário para quem os direitos estão sendo adicionados. |
Deny |
Opcional |
System.Management.Automation.SwitchParameter |
O parâmetro Deny é uma opção que, se incluída, nega a permissão especificada. |
InheritanceType |
Opcional |
System.DirectoryServices.ActiveDirectorySecurityInheritance |
O parâmetro InheritanceType especifica o tipo de herança. Os valores válidos são:
|
Server |
Opcional |
Microsoft.Exchange.Configuration.Tasks.ServerIdParameter |
O parâmetro Server especifica o servidor no qual executar as operações selecionadas. |
Tipos de entrada
Tipos de retorno
Erros
Erro | Descrição |
---|---|
|
Exceções
Exceções | Descrição |
---|---|
|
Exemplo
No primeiro exemplo, a permissão ViewInformationStore é atribuída a um usuário chamado Chris na pasta pública denominada MyPublicFolder.
No segundo exemplo, o parâmetro Deny é adicionado ao comando do primeiro exemplo, que nega ao usuário chamado Chris a permissão ViewInformationStore.
Add-PublicFolderAdministrativePermission -User Chris -Identity \MyPublicFolder -AccessRights ViewInformationStore
Add-PublicFolderAdministrativePermission -User Chris -Identity \MyPublicFolder -AccessRights ViewInformationStore -Deny
Use o cmdlet Add-PublicFolderClientPermission para adicionar permissões de usuário a uma pasta pública. Para obter mais informações, consulte Add-PublicFolderClientPermission (RTM).